Output 595a12e08977edefe891df2c8301ff86baf58d162955a66f219a2ea426afcd9f:0

value
12923391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30bbf8fd3c05d81002a83a7e7c213a1d94d74508 OP_EQUALVERIFY OP_CHECKSIG
address
15Sgcmtuk43mnmaARsqSwPuszLzTRLxEdC
transaction
595a12e08977edefe891df2c8301ff86baf58d162955a66f219a2ea426afcd9f
spent
true